In Universal we found there to be plenty of machines. Never had issues with wasps or leaking mugs as previous people have said. TBH I cant see how the actual mug would leak, maybe the lid if not held up straight while full, but the actual mugs are double walled.

2 in the water parks is good, as they can be refilled every 2 minutes.

I do remember a Universal trick that we used, worked 9 out of 10 times. If you use the freestyle machines, the timer is a refill every 10 minutes, but if you go to a kiosk, most of the workers didnt check, especially if asking for the ice drinks (could be they checked if the mug was valid but they dont see the timer).
